Do workers at Staples get paid breaks?

No. Most people don’t get paid breaks.
72% of people say they don’t get paid breaks.
Based on data from 92 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between November 2025 and May 2026.

Does Staples pay people when they’re sick?

Sometimes. Only some people get paid when they’re sick.
54% of people say they wouldn’t get paid if they were sick but scheduled to work.
Based on data from 93 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between December 2025 and May 2026.

How far ahead of time do people find out their work schedule?

Most people find out their schedule less than four weeks ahead of time.
  • 58% of people with changing schedules find out their shifts one week or less ahead of time.
  • 36% of people with changing schedules find out their shifts two weeks ahead of time.
  • 7% of people with changing schedules find out their shifts three weeks ahead of time.
  • 0% of people with changing schedules find out their shifts four weeks or more ahead of time.

Based on data from 73 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between December 2025 and May 2026.

Is it stressful to work at Staples?

Most people feel stressed out here.
90% of people say they often feel stressed out at work.
Based on data from 98 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between December 2025 and May 2026.

Job description

Staples is business to business. You're what binds us together.

While you may know Staples as the world's leading office supply company, Staples Promotional Products - a division of Staples - is a national leader in the promotional products industry. At Staples Promotional Products, we help customers build love for their brands with customized merchandise solutions. Whatever story they want to tell, connection they want to make, or goal they need to deliver, Staples Promo makes it easy to design promo experiences that create lasting impact. Join our winning team!

Shift Hours:  7:00am-3:30pm/Monday-Friday

Pay:  $19.00/Hourly

We offer pay for performance where associates can earn additional compensation if they meet certain productivity thresholds.

What you'll be doing:

  • Utilizes Pick-To-Voice technology to pick and pack product to fulfill customer orders or product to be decorated.
  • Assists in other areas of distribution as needed (ie. inventory, returns, shipping, receiving, etc.).
  • Follows orders to pick product throughout our warehouse and confirms orders on the system.
  • Garment prepping, making sure counts are correct, and product is ready to go into production for a piece rate operator.
  • Puts production in specified bins once work is received in.
  • Replenishes bins throughout warehouse.

 What you bring to the table:

  • Ability to collaborate in nature, able to work with internal and external partners to achieve results.
  • Ability to delivering projects on time.
  • Good safety-focused and can follow all procedures in the performance of job duties.
  • Ability to accurately pick customer orders with less than 4 errors per month.
  • Ability to attend to details to ensure items are packed and shipped accurately.
  • Ability to understand and follow written or verbal instructions.

What's needed- Basic Qualifications:

  • High School Diploma or equivalent preferred.
  • Ability to lift up to 50 lbs. 50% of the time.
  • Ability to walk and stand 100% of the time.
  • Basic English language skills (both verbal and written communications). 

What's needed- Preferred Qualifications:

  • Prior related experience.
